Résumé

"I LOVE this book. It flowed perfectly from beginning to end. I couldn't put it down." All is set to change for Alice and Sam as they expect their first child together. Just how they are going to fit themselves, their baby and Sam's daughter Sophie into their little two-bed cottage is a mystery, but Alice is determined not to get stressed out. Her focus is on best friend Julie, who is trying unsuccessfully for a baby, and on Sophie, who is torn between staying in Cornwall with Sam, or moving to Devon with her mum. Then there are Alice's parents, who don't seem happy with their own move to Cornwall, and Jonathan, who also appears to be falling out of love with life there.
At least work is going well, with a glowing review of Amethi in Staycation magazine, and the possibility of picking up some tourism awards. But it should be no surprise when life throws a couple more challenges in the way. Can Alice really survive her pregnancy stress-free, and can her friendship with Julie survive the strain of the differing situations they now find themselves in?
